martin5789 wrote: ↑Mon Feb 12, 2018 9:10 pm Mine does have trim rattles which are annoyingly intermittent so difficult to diagnose. The OPC's MO is to send a fitter out with you (I've already had some sorted) and that will be the day it decides not to do it.

Martin - I had an elusive rattle for a while and I was convinced it was coming from somewhere in the centre console. OPC tried but couldn't solve and I eventually traced it to the sunroof seals. Its and easy fix - from inside the car with the sunroof open, smear a very light coating of silicon grease all the way around the upper surface of the seal with one finger. So worth trying just to eliminate it from your enquiries as it were. Also worth doing the same for the door seals just in case one of them is the source (solved a persistent rattle in my wife's Golf this way).
